In category theory, a branch of mathematics, a pullback (also called a fibered product or Cartesian square) is the limit of a diagram consisting of two morphisms f : X ¿ Z and g : Y ¿ Z with a common codomain; it is the limit of the cospan X rightarrow Z leftarrow Y. The pullback is often written P = X times_Z Y., In mathematics, category theory deals in an abstract way with mathematical structures and relationships between them: it abstracts from sets and functions to objects linked in diagrams by morphisms or arrows.
